Output 841bfd18593386941cff322633cf9c5d2dc8a1609ad77f9d37261d03b6f10f76:6

value
198673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5a00cabed58492a6dda78b35dd47d8c3b20fdb OP_EQUAL
address
3Mxhkevce2cft4mR2HU7dVdesB8cT1WSxt
transaction
841bfd18593386941cff322633cf9c5d2dc8a1609ad77f9d37261d03b6f10f76
confirmations
415745
spent
true